Description Responsible for work related to the Community College Opportunity Grant (CCOG) program and assigned tasks affecting the operation of Student Services-related activities, with a priority focus on students eligible for the Community College Opportunity Grant. This grant‑funded position ends June 30 2026, not to exceed 24 hours worked per week. It is a part‑time, temporary position.
Examples of Duties
Provides customer service to current and prospective student inquiries and communicates (in‑person, telephone, email, print) with a strong knowledge of college policies and procedures relating to financial aid and Community College Opportunity Grant.
Verifies enrollment status, student academic progress status, award notices, and monitors adjustments/award changes related to the Community College Opportunity Grant.
Assists in cross‑checking admissions applications and works with the registrar’s office when validating enrollment status of aid recipients within the college’s designated Student Information System.
Assists with entering and maintaining Federal, State, and Institutional awards into the college’s designated Student Information System.
Works with third‑party software programs and companies to enter, maintain, and reconcile financial aid related information into the college’s designated Student Information System.
Counsels current and prospective students and their families through appointments, presentations, via in‑person virtual and/or off‑campus events of the Community College Opportunity Grant.
Assists in gathering data for the completion of required federal and state reports and fund reconciliation with the Bursar’s office.
Assists with preparation, maintenance, and updates of financial aid files in Banner and the TAB filing system.
Performs other duties, as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ications
Associate’s degree or equivalent combination of education and experience that will provide comparable knowledge and abilities.
Minimum of two (2) to four (4) years of higher‑education experience. Financial aid experience preferred.
Excellent written and oral communication skills, including public speaking and one‑on‑one advisement.
Knowledge of Student Information Systems.
Desire and willingness to work flexible schedules with variable hours, including evenings and possible weekends.
Possess the ability to work well and communicate effectively with prospective and current students, staff, faculty, administration, colleagues, and community partners.
